Abstract

Disclosed herein are a new N2,N4-bis(4-(piperazin-1-yl)phenyl)pyrimidin-2,4-diamine derivative or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of and a pharmaceutical composition for the prevention or treatment of cancers containing the same as an active ingredient. The compound of the present invention has excellent inhibitory effects against the activities of anaplastic lymphoma kinase (ALK) and activated cdc42-associated kinase (ACK1) and thus can improve the therapeutic effects on the treatment of cancer cells having anaplastic lymphoma kinase fusion proteins such as EML4-ALK and NPM-ALK, and also effectively prevent the recurrence of cancers thus being useful as a pharmaceutical composition for the prevention and treatment of cancers.
